Transaction edfba064dc80a0f2b475cb4e7abc918b9be06488b99e590769b734cad4966b29

8 Input
1 Outputs
  • edfba064dc80a0f2b475cb4e7abc918b9be06488b99e590769b734cad4966b29:0
  • value  66354044
    address  1JyQAK9CJPJiBqNQAsJPvQ2XsbYiV6FRDe